Part II Architectural Assistant Job in North London

An award-winning, design-led practice has a new role for a Part II Architectural Assistant. This is an excellent opportunity for a motivated and enthusiastic individual to gain experience across all RIBA stages, with a particular focus on early-stage residential and workplace projects.

The studio is known for delivering thoughtful, high-quality architecture across London. With a collaborative culture, a commitment to sustainable design, and a flexible working environment, it offers a supportive setting for career development.

Role & Responsibilities

  • Assist in the preparation, development and editing of drawings, models, and supporting design documentation
  • Support the project lead across all project stages, with an emphasis on concept through to planning (RIBA 0-3)
  • Produce visual representations and develop design options for team review
  • Contribute to plan checks and ensure high-quality project delivery
  • Communicate clearly with team members, consultants, and other stakeholders
  • Research materials, construction methods and sustainable design techniques
  • Ensure compliance with UK Building Regulations and British Standards
  • Understand and align with the practice's values and way of working.

Required Skills & Experience

  • Strong design and drawing skills (digital and hand-drawn)
  • Experience with Vectorworks would be beneficial but training would be offered
  • Experience working on early-stage residential and/or workplace schemes
  • Proficiency in Adobe Creative Suite
  • Good communication skills and the ability to work within a team
  • Understanding of project briefs, deadlines, and budget constraints
  • A collaborative approach and willingness to learn
  • Ability to work independently, using initiative where needed
  • Working knowledge of RIBA stages 0-3 is essential
  • Knowledge of construction detailing and RIBA Stages 3-6 is beneficial
  • Interest in low-carbon design and adaptive reuse
  • Comfortable managing multiple projects or workstreams.

What You Get Back

  • £30,000 - £35,000
  • 20 days annual leave + bank holidays
  • Christmas closure
  • Ongoing training and development support
  • Regular CPD's
  • Weekly 'knowledge sessions' to discuss various industry topics
  • Flexible Fridays - option to work remotely every Friday
  • Flexible working available around practice core hours (10am-4pm).
